Index of /_SITEIMAGE/image/YWUtcGljLWExLmFsaWV4cHJlc3MtbWVkaWEuY29t/4a/c9/d2/2d
Name
Last modified
Size
Description
Parent Directory
-
4ac9d22df3e827183b18..>
2025-07-08 20:44
115K